Bankruptcy offers a split from creditors. A major benefit of bankruptcy is usually that it provides both of those short term and long-lasting relief from creditors. An “automated keep” helps prevent them from this website attempting to acquire money from you even though the bankruptcy is pending and offers momentary security from foreclosure, eviction and vehicle repossession.

You are able to continue to keep some property. Bankruptcy may well need you to provide some assets to pay off your debts. However, you received’t lose everything, due to the fact bankruptcy exemption regulations shield your private home, vehicle, garments together with other valuables up towards the dollar amounts shown below.
